Subject: DocLint cut-over complete

Team,

The Fernwick documentation linter cut over to the new rule engine last night. Old pipeline is retired; all repos now validate against ruleset v4. Two repos needed suppression files, already merged. No build failures since the switch. Rollback window closes Friday. Marit owns follow-up triage. For verification, the linter service now boots with the following configuration.

settings of tagef-bawif:
DRUIX_HOST=druix.zemvarlabs.internal
DRUIX_PORT=8000

- [ ] **Step 7: Breaker override escrow.** After sealing the signing keys for the Tallgrove upstream API circuit breaker, confirm the support team can force the breaker open during a full outage. The override bundle lives in the sealed escrow drawer and is useless without its unlock phrase. Two ceremony witnesses must initial this step before proceeding. The escrow bundle is decrypted with the recovery passphrase that follows.

vault phrase of kahip-kahop = holath-quenmir

MINUTES — Management Meeting, Thornquist Holdings

Attendees: Vel, Omara, Juris. Topic: hedging exposure on the Kelvarian mark. Decision: forward contracts covering 60% of projected Q3 receivables; remainder floats. Omara to brief branch managers by Friday. Review in six weeks. The rationale ties directly to the confidential plan noted below.

confidential, kagup-bafog: Fraaxax Group is in early talks to buy Soroxox Group for about $343.8 million. The Olidor launch date is June 14, and nothing goes to the press before then. Legal wants the Aldmirek Logistics term sheet signed before July 23.

Subject: Scanner cut-over summary

Welcome aboard. Over the weekend we migrated the Quillguard typo-squatting scanner from the batch pipeline to the streaming service. Registry events are now analyzed within seconds rather than hourly, and the old cron jobs have been disabled. Alert routing and quarantine behavior are unchanged. So you can orient yourself, the scanner's current production configuration is included below.

deployment values, kagap-kawep:
GILATH_PIN=9112
GILATH_TENANT=casix
GILATH_METRICS_HOST=metrics.gilath.paliqsys.corp
GILATH_SEAL=seal_c47e3442
GILATH_STANDBY_TEAM=belvan